Most everyone knows that your lender will try to collect from you if you don't pay your bills. When they can't solve the debt problem themselves they usually hire a collection agency to recover the delinquent account. These collection agencies must stay within the compliance of the law. You as a debtor are protected by the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A). When an agency acts outside these guide lines they are subject to stiff fines, penalties and lawsuits.
